capp-pub:序列化发布docker-compose项目的一种方法

时间:2021-03-08 05:53:46
【文件属性】:
文件名称:capp-pub:序列化发布docker-compose项目的一种方法
文件大小:31KB
文件格式:ZIP
更新时间:2021-03-08 05:53:46
Go 分叉于: 还包括符合和。 为什么 Docker-compose很棒,但它留下了纯粹的Docker解决的一个关键问题:分发。 capp-pub致力于解决这个问题。 它基本上捕获了在另一个系统上运行确切的docker-compose文件所需的所有信息。 但是尽管如此,一旦您掌握了所有这些信息,就可以生产一个真正的轻量级工具来运行无需Docker(或Golang)的docker-compose应用程序,这并不是一个很大的飞跃。 该工具查看docker-compose和每个容器,并生成可以由crun项目执行的runc规范。 设置运行需要一点帮助,因此创建了一个免费的工具capp-run,它能够运行此工具创建的捆绑软件。 目标是几乎像Docker一样运行任何docker-compose文件。 我们永远都做不到,但应该能够涵盖大多数正常使用情况。 希望这种妥协值得用capp-run / cru
【文件预览】:
capp-pub-main
----.gitignore(6B)
----go.mod(1KB)
----Makefile(908B)
----LICENSE(11KB)
----go.sum(30KB)
----main.go(3KB)
----README.md(2KB)
----example()
--------test-oom.sh(128B)
--------test-tmpfs.sh(265B)
--------test-caps.sh(151B)
--------docker-compose.yml(2KB)
--------test-common-options.sh(434B)
--------test-sysctls.sh(137B)
--------test-user.sh(162B)
----golangci.yml(181B)
----internal()
--------runc.go(7KB)
--------publish.go(9KB)
--------reg_client.go(6KB)

网友评论